Live Dealer Blackjack Fundamentals: Building Your Foundation
Live dealer blackjack follows the same rules as its brick‑and‑mortar counterpart. The dealer deals two cards to each player and two to themselves, one face‑up and one face‑down. Your goal is to beat the dealer’s hand without exceeding 21.
Key terms you’ll hear at the table include RTP (return‑to‑player), house edge, soft hand, hard hand, and split. Most live tables offer an RTP of around 99.5 %, which means the game is very fair over the long run. The house edge typically sits between 0.5 % and 1 % for standard rules.
Understanding volatility helps you pick the right table. Low‑volatility tables give frequent small wins, while high‑volatility tables offer bigger payouts but more swings. Choose a volatility level that matches your bankroll and risk tolerance.

Master Basic Strategy
Basic strategy charts show the mathematically optimal move for every player hand versus the dealer’s up‑card. Memorize the chart or keep a printable cheat sheet nearby. Using basic strategy reduces the house edge to under 0.5 %.

Use the “Insurance” Wisely
Insurance is a side bet that the dealer has blackjack. Statistically, it’s a losing bet in the long run. Only take insurance if you have a proven advantage, such as a high count in card‑counting systems.
